Significance
The authors report the synthesis, characterization, and synthetic application of 2-aryl-1,1,2,2-tetrafluoroethylcopper complexes. Starting with a carbocupration of tetrafluoroethylene (TFE), a variety of 1,2-difunctionalized 1,1,2,2-tetrafluoroethanes were prepared in high yields.

Comment
The molecular structure of the aryl–TFE–copper species was determined by X-ray crystallography and NMR analysis. Furthermore, the synthetic utility for liquid-crystalline compounds bearing a tetrafluoroethylene-bridging structure was demonstrated.
